			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I love <a href="http://penguinday.org/">Penguin Day</a>. One of my favorite days of the year. Always comes right around <a href="http://nten.org/ntc">NTC</a>. This year, it&#8217;s before NTC, on Saturday, April 25. It&#8217;s a day dedicated to conversation and community around nonprofits and open source software. There&#8217;s some great stuff on <a href="http://pd.aspirationtech.org/index.php/Penguin_Day_Agenda">the Agenda</a>, like:</p>
<ul>
<li>Introduction to Free and Open Source Software</li>
<li> Fundraising with all free software</li>
<li> Free And Open Source Online Advocacy: Tools And Best Practices</li>
<li>Making sense of Free and Open Source Content Management Systems</li>
<li>Introduction to Blogging with WordPress</li>
<li> Intro and Advanced sessions on Joomla! and Drupal</li>
<li>CiviCRM vs Salesforce.com: What Are the Differences?</li>
<li>Mobile Volunteering: The ExtraOrdinaries Project</li>
<li>Creative Commons And Open Content</li>
<li>And many more&#8230;</li>
</ul>
<p>You can register at <a href="http://penguinday.org/">Penguinday.org</a>. Thanks to the generosity of Google, we&#8217;re delighted to grant fee waivers to anyone who needs one!</p>
